Moodle — The Versatile LMS Platform
Moodle is one of the most widely used open-source LMS platforms, offering course creation, student tracking, communication channels, and scalability. However, it has limitations in tracking learner experiences outside of structured course frameworks.
xAPI — The Revolution in Learning Data
xAPI (Experience API / Tin Can API) tracks learning experiences across multiple platforms — within an LMS, in VR environments, on mobile apps, or in real-world settings. Unlike SCORM, xAPI captures data from any learning experience with real-time collection, rich reporting, and platform-agnostic interoperability.
Real-Time Tracking of Learning Experiences
- Scenario-based Learning: Track learner decisions and actions in simulations or interactive videos outside Moodle
- Mobile Learning: Capture progress and interactions even when learners aren’t logged into Moodle
- Informal Learning: Track social interactions, forums, peer reviews, and on-the-job tasks
Enhanced Analytics and Reporting
- Granular Learning Data: Detailed reports on specific learner actions and content effectiveness
- Learner Engagement: Track decision-making and learning path progression
- Predictive Analytics: Identify at-risk learners for early intervention
Immersive and Adaptive Learning Paths
Combining Moodle’s course management with xAPI’s personalized tracking enables adaptive learning paths based on performance, preferences, and behaviors. Integration with VR/AR platforms creates truly immersive experiences for medical training, skills training, and complex simulations, with xAPI tracking every action.
Transform Your Publishing Workflow
Our experts can help you build scalable, API-driven publishing systems tailored to your business.
How to Integrate Moodle with xAPI
- Install an xAPI plugin for Moodle
- Configure a Learning Record Store (LRS) to collect and analyze xAPI data
- Create xAPI statements to track learner interactions and activities
- Customize data collection based on learning goals
- Leverage analytics from Moodle and LRS for custom reports and insights
Conclusion
Moodle and xAPI together create immersive, adaptive, and data-driven learning experiences beyond traditional LMS platforms. By tracking every experience — formal and informal — and creating personalized learning paths, this combination is paving the way for next-generation learning that is personalized, efficient, and engaging.
MetaDesign Solutions: Moodle and xAPI Development
MetaDesign Solutions builds immersive learning platforms using Moodle and xAPI — creating learning experiences that go beyond traditional LMS boundaries. Our EdTech team implements xAPI tracking for simulations, VR training, mobile learning, and real-world performance support, unified in Moodle's learning analytics dashboard.
Services include Moodle LMS customization and deployment, xAPI Learning Record Store integration, custom xAPI activity provider development, learning analytics dashboard creation, SCORM-to-xAPI migration, and multi-platform learning experience design. Contact MetaDesign Solutions for next-generation Moodle learning experiences.




